Abstract

The integration of fifth-generation (5G) technology with Non-Terrestrial Networks (NTN) holds transformative potential for Beyond Visual Line of Sight (BVLOS) operations of Uncrewed Aerial Systems (UAS) in rural regions. This paper presents a comprehensive architectural design that leverages satellite-enabled 5G networks to enhance connectivity in the Orkney Islands, Scotland, thereby improving the reliability and operational efficiency of UAS missions. By addressing the limitations of terrestrial networks, particularly in remote and underserved areas, the proposed flowchart ensures seamless data communication and transfer, facilitating real-time control and monitoring within the UAS platform. Simulations are conducted to validate the scenario for remote area connectivity. This work underscores the crucial role of NTN in advancing UAS operations, paving the way for innovative services and broader adoption of UAS technologies in rural settings.
